Nokia 3310 is Back But You Won’t Want to Get It

The Nokia 3310 is back but you won’t want to and you should not get it, especially if you are staying in Singapore. When Nokia announced it, it created a buzz online. Everyone loves this nostalgic handset that also comes with the iconic Snake game.

If you check out the specs, you will understand why I say that you should not get it. It is on 2.5G Cellular Network and Singapore has announced that from 2017 (this year), it will stop the sales of 2G mobile sets (except for export only).

Here is the Nokia 3310 specs:-

IN THE BOX

  • Your Nokia 3310
  • Nokia Micro-USB charger
  • WH-108 headset*
  • Quick guide
  • *Varies by market, please check availability.

DESIGN

  • Colors Warm Red (Glossy), Dark Blue (Matte), Yellow (Glossy), Grey (Matte)
  • Size 115.6 x 51 x 12.8 mm
  • NETWORK AND CONNECTIVITY
  • Network speed 2G
  • Networks GSM 900/1800 MHz
  • PERFORMANCE
  • Operating system Nokia Series 30+

STORAGE

  • Internal memory 16 MB4
  • MicroSD card slot Support for up to 32 GB, memory card sold separately
  • AUDIO
  • Connector 3.5 mm AV connector
  • Apps FM radio, MP3 player
  • DISPLAY
  • Size and type 2.4” QVGA

CAMERA

  • Primary camera 2MP
  • Flash LED flash
  • CONNECTIVITY
  • Connectivity Micro USB (USB 2.0), Bluetooth 3.0 with SLAM

BATTERY LIFE

  • Battery type Removable 1200 mAh battery5
  • Max. talk time Up to 22.1 hours
  • Max. standby time Up to 31 days
  • Max. MP3 playback time Up to 51 hours
  • Max. FM radio playback time Up to 39 hours

In another separate report, StarHub and M1 has announced that they will not be bringing in this handset. It make sense because Singapore will be disabling the 2G network from 1st April 2017. That is just about 1 month+ away.

So, even if you love the Nokia 3310, think carefully before you want to buy it from 3rd party sources. It may just become a dummy phone from day 1.
